引言
SHELL编程是一种基础的编程技能,对于初学者来说,它是一个很好的起点。本文将带您深入了解SHELL编程,探讨它为何适合孩子学习,以及如何通过SHELL编程开启编程之旅。
什么是SHELL编程?
1.1 什么是SHELL?
SHELL是操作系统的用户界面,它允许用户与操作系统交互。在Linux和Unix系统中,SHELL是最常用的用户界面。
1.2 SHELL编程的特点
- 简单易学:SHELL编程语言相对简单,易于上手。
- 命令行操作:通过命令行执行各种操作,如文件管理、系统管理等。
- 跨平台:SHELL编程在多种操作系统上都可以运行。
为什么SHELL编程适合孩子学习?
2.1 简单入门
SHELL编程的语法简单,适合初学者。孩子可以通过学习SHELL编程,逐步建立起编程思维。
2.2 培养逻辑思维
SHELL编程需要编写命令序列来完成任务,这有助于培养孩子的逻辑思维能力。
2.3 提高计算机操作能力
通过SHELL编程,孩子可以更好地了解计算机操作系统的内部机制,提高计算机操作能力。
如何学习SHELL编程?
3.1 选择合适的教材
对于孩子来说,选择一本适合他们年龄和水平的SHELL编程教材非常重要。以下是一些推荐的教材:
- 《Linux命令行与shell脚本编程大全》
- 《SHELL脚本编程艺术》
3.2 实践操作
学习SHELL编程的关键在于实践。以下是一些实践建议:
- 安装Linux操作系统或使用虚拟机。
- 学习基本的Linux命令。
- 编写简单的SHELL脚本,如自动备份文件、清理磁盘空间等。
3.3 加入编程社区
加入编程社区,如GitHub、Stack Overflow等,可以让孩子在学习过程中得到更多帮助和灵感。
SHELL编程的实际应用
SHELL编程在实际应用中非常广泛,以下是一些例子:
- 自动化任务:通过编写SHELL脚本,可以自动化日常任务,如备份文件、更新软件等。
- 系统管理:SHELL编程可以用于系统管理,如配置网络、监控系统性能等。
- 开发工具:SHELL编程可以用于开发各种工具,如自动化测试、代码生成等。
总结
SHELL编程是开启孩子编程之旅的奇妙之门。通过学习SHELL编程,孩子可以培养编程思维、提高计算机操作能力,并为未来的编程学习打下坚实的基础。让我们一起探索SHELL编程的奇妙世界吧!
